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65830451 50360364304 158115 2904
77579761 174719266 549897
77579761 174719266 549897
16931609 65 39342
All about undefined
Interested in learning more?
77579761 174719266 549897
16931609 65 39342
See more
991541313 9426216720
126267 681956 635
See more
458 622753951
11247 375 1075
See more